About Drift Toppers Snowmobile Club Of Duluth
Drift Toppers Snowmobile Club Of Duluth (EIN: 521279296) is a nonprofit organization based in Duluth, MN. The organization reported total revenue of $253K and total assets of $184K according to its most recent IRS 990 filing. Filing History
IRS 990 filing history for Drift Toppers Snowmobile Club Of Duluth showing financial trends over 1 year of public records:
In its most recent filing year (2023), Drift Toppers Snowmobile Club Of Duluth reported a surplus of $47K, with revenue exceeding expenses.
| Year | Revenue | Expenses | Assets | Liabilities | Officer Comp. |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2023 | $50K | $3K | $163K | $0 | — | View 990 |
